The seal coating of our roads was completed in November and I thank you for your cooperation.  Keep in mind that the black coating will eventually fade to a grayish color.  This is to be expected due to the exposure to the sun.  We are now on track with a regular maintenance program for our roads.

  DHEC has initiated new regulations for swimming pool filtration systems therefore; we will be converting to a salt system. The pool season has also been changed to April 15 through October 15.  Please remind your guests of our pool rules and regulations.
